ARTISAN HOUSE
NEW UPSCALE EATERY & BAR IN DOWNTOWN L.A.

Downtown L.A. just got a little more lively with the addition of Artisan House, a new restaurant, bar, deli and market specializing in local, seasonal fare hand-crafted by skilled artisans.

Revelers have a new cool bar and swank restaurant to go to, while downtown locals now have a healthy market to shop at. Artisan House is located in the historic Pacific Electric Building on Main Street.

Around the corner from favorite hangouts such as Cole’s, the originator of the French dip sandwich, along with über cool bars Varnish, and The Association, the downtown landscape just got hotter with another place walking distance to pub crawl to, or a great location to dine and drink.

Artisan House is where downtown chic meets SoCal gastroculture.  Distinguished by an upscale California Mediterranean menu, comfortable atmosphere and a ninth-floor event space, it offers a new go-to place for the downtown crowd, a stone’s throw away from Pershing Square and the Fashion District, and for residents of the building itself, a nine-story 1905 landmark more recently redesigned as urban loft-style apartment homes.

In fact, Artisan House looks to be a destination for foodies both adventurous and socially responsible as its name refers to the farmers and boutique food makers plying their trade in the region surrounding Los Angeles, producing simple, quality, old-world-style products. While growing a breadth of fresh herbs and specialty vegetables in its own rooftop garden, Artisan House is committed to working with these suppliers, creating dishes from seasonal and organic ingredients and presenting them in a welcoming atmosphere with an uncompromised attention to quality and service.

The menu offers a wide range of delicacies for breakfast, lunch and dinner. Items include soups, salads, small treats like Bacon-Stuffed Blue Cheese Wrapped Dates, Escargots Casino, Burrata and Scottish Lox, to hearty sandwiches and flatbreads, and decadent desserts.

Mixologist Elden McFeron III (The Abbey, Samba, The Bazaar @ SLS Hotel) is overseeing the hand crafted cocktails, which include El Margarita, cryofrozen with liquid nitrogen; and Blood N Sand Artisan Way, a “square” of Scotch topped with orange foam, orange zest, and drizzled cherry brandy and sweet vermouth reduction. Among its signature and seasonal cocktails are the vodka-based Artisan Bouquet, the 4-Leaf Agave with tequila cacao, maple syrup and Guinness; the Collaboration, a twist on the classic Manhattan with rye whiskey, maraschino juice, port, sweet vermouth and bitters; and Winter Squash, a mash-up of gin, chardonnay and sweetened pumpkin juice, garnished w/lemon peel.

Artisan House is located at 600 South Main Street. Hours: Monday through Friday…Lunch from 11:30 a.m. to 2:30 p.m.; Dinner seven nights a week from 5:30 p.m. to 10:30 p.m.; Saturday and Sunday brunch from 9:30 a.m. to 2:30 p.m. The bar is open daily from 11:30 a.m. to 1:30 a.m. The deli/market is open Sunday through Wednesday from 7 a.m. to midnight, and Thursday through Saturday from 7 a.m. to 3 a.m. Street parking and parking lots adjacent to building; valet parking $2, validation provided with Lunch Special.
